A hypothetical life restoration of Ampelosaurus atacis

• Ampelosaurus is known from hundreds of fossil specimens which show most of the dinosaur's osteological details, however, there are few articulated remains or reconstructions of the material so its overall proportions and life appearance are uncertain.
• Ampelosaurus is known to have supported osteoderms, only four are currently known. The number of these osteoderms that an individual Ampelosaurus would have supported in life and their and position on the body is not currently known. It's thought that due to the rarity of titanosaur osteoderms that they would be quite sparse on the body. The position and layout of the osteoderms has been loosely based on this interpretation, which is based on the work of Vidal et al 2015. [1]

Reconstruction of Tuebingosaurus maierfritzorum gen. et sp. nov. as a quadruped dinosaur, using the outline of Riojasaurus as a base ‒ next to the silhouette of Friedrich von Huene. The drawing of the bones is based on and modified from the original illustrations of specimen “GPIT IV” in von Huene (1932, pl. 38) that have been replicated in the literature. The right fibula is marked in grey as it was found nearby with similar measurements to the left fibula and has been assumed to be part of the same individual.

Achelousaurus horneri skull, collected in Glacier County, Montana, at the Museum of the Rockies in Bozeman, Montana.
The Ceratopsidae are those dinosaurs with head frills.  There are three large subgroups of Ceratopsidae: Centrosaurinae, Ceratopsinae, and Chasmosaurinae. The Triceratopsini are a "tribe" of the Chasmosaurinae -- a genus so vast that it gets the special name "tribe".  The Pachyrhinosaurini are a "tribe" within the Centrosaurinae.

Achelousaurus is a genus within the Pachyrhinosaurini.  So far, only three skulls and some limited skeletal remains have been collected anywhere in the world -- and all of them in Montana.  Their bony frills are quite similar to the Styracosaurus albertensis, although their other skull features (such as big bony bosses on the nose and behind the eyes) are not.

Reconstructed skull of Jaxartosaurus aralensis Riabinin, 1937. Only a posterior portion of the skull, as well as a surangular is known, with the rest of the skull being based mostly upon File:Aralosaurus skull.png. Jaxartosaurus is currently classified as a basal lambeosaurine, more derived than Aralosaurini, but more primitive than Parasaurolophini and Lambeosaurini. It might be more derived than Tsintaosaurini (Godefroit et al., 2004). References:

Rendition of possible appearance of the dinosaur genus Nyasasaurus from the Middle Triassic, possibly the earliest known dinosaur.  Black portions represent the partial skeletal fragments (a humerus and six vertebrae) from one specimen blue portions represent fragments from a second specimen (three cervical vertebrae) on which the current likely form of the animal is based.

Figure 1: Geographic provenance and speculative reconstruction of the gigantic titanosaurian sauropod dinosaur Notocolossus gonzalezparejasi gen. et sp. nov.
(a) Type locality of Notocolossus (indicated by star) in southern-most Mendoza Province, Argentina. (b) Reconstructed skeleton and body silhouette in right lateral view, with preserved elements of the holotype (UNCUYO-LD 301) in light green and those of the referred specimen (UNCUYO-LD 302) in orange. Scale bar, 1 m. (All images were hand drawn by the senior author [B.J.G.R.] and subsequently edited using Adobe Illustrator software.)

New Jurassic Fossil Reveals How Birds Lost Their Dinosaur Tails
Un nouveau fossile jurassique révèle comment les oiseaux ont perdu leur queue de dinosaure
Chine Jurassique fossile Dinosauria Zhengheornis oiseau
Des paléontologues chinois ont décrit un petit oiseau jurassique jusqu'alors inconnu dont la queue courte offre de nouvelles preuves de la façon dont les premiers oiseaux ont troqué leur longue queue semblable à celle d'un dinosaure contre le coccyx compact qui aide les oiseaux vivants à voler.
